The Evolution of Player Engagement: From Static to Dynamic Experiences
Traditionally, game engagement relied on compelling narratives and polished graphics. Today, however, that approach alone is insufficient. The emergence of live updates, personalised content, and social features have created a more dynamic ecosystem that demands continuous innovation. Developing a deep understanding of these elements is critical for game developers seeking to optimise player retention.

Emerging Technologies Driving Future Engagement
- Augmented Reality (AR) & Virtual Reality (VR): Creating immersive environments that blur the line between the digital and physical worlds.
- Artificial Intelligence (AI): Personalising experiences based on player behaviour and preferences.
- Blockchain & NFTs: Introducing new monetisation avenues and player ownership rights that foster community loyalty.
